Labour’s Leadership Questions Deepen as Burnham’s Viability is Challenged

Political tensions within the UK Labour Party have escalated following the defection of Conservative MP Danny Kruger to Reform UK. This move raises significant questions about the party’s leadership and the viability of Andy Burnham as a potential successor to Keir Starmer. Kruger’s assertion that the Conservative Party is “over, over as a national party” highlights ongoing divisions in the right of British politics, potentially complicating Labour’s path to electoral success.
During a recent press conference, Nigel Farage, the leader of Reform UK, was asked whether he would prefer to face Starmer or Burnham in the next general election. Farage suggested that Starmer’s tenure was nearing its end and claimed Burnham would push Labour too far left to maintain electoral support. His comments reflect a broader concern within the Labour Party about the implications of a leftward shift in policy.
The prospect of Burnham as Prime Minister raises concerns about his ability to navigate the complexities of national governance. While he enjoys popularity as the Mayor of Manchester, the challenges of managing UK-wide issues are formidable. A hypothetical Burnham premiership would not automatically result in economic revitalization or an immediate increase in public spending. Instead, he would likely inherit a series of pressing issues, including managing public debt and reforming the National Health Service (NHS).
Burnham’s approach to economic policy could lean towards a “tax and spend” model, potentially modeled after the strategies of former Labour leader Ed Miliband. This could alienate financial markets and stifle investment. For instance, Miliband’s previous leadership bid in 2015, characterized by a similar strategy, failed to resonate with voters, leading to a decisive defeat.
